Check Licensing and Player Protection First
A regulated casino should make its licensing information easy to find. For UK users, this typically means checking whether the operator is authorised by the relevant national regulator and whether its policies explain how funds, personal data, complaints, and safer gambling are handled.
- Look for clear operator and licence details.
- Read the privacy policy before submitting personal information.
- Confirm that deposits and withdrawals use secure payment technology.
- Review identity verification requirements in advance.
- Find visible links to deposit limits, reality checks, and self-exclusion tools.
Security is not limited to a padlock symbol in the browser. A trustworthy platform should also explain how it protects accounts, detects unusual activity, and processes withdrawals. Transparent terms are often a stronger sign of quality than an unusually large welcome offer.

Read Bonus Conditions Before Opting In
Promotions can add entertainment value, yet the headline figure rarely tells the whole story. A bonus may include wagering requirements, maximum bet restrictions, game contribution rules, expiry dates, payment limitations, and a cap on eligible winnings. Each condition can affect the real usefulness of the offer.
Players should pay particular attention to whether a bonus is automatically activated, whether withdrawing cancels remaining funds, and whether bonus wagering must be completed before a cash balance can be withdrawn. A smaller promotion with straightforward terms may be more suitable than a larger offer with demanding conditions.
Make Payments Practical and Predictable
Payment choice should match both convenience and control. Bank cards can be familiar, e-wallets may provide faster account handling, and bank transfers can suit larger transactions, although processing times differ. The casino should state minimum and maximum amounts, possible charges, and estimated withdrawal periods.
Verification requests are common, especially before a first withdrawal. Keeping identification documents current and ensuring that payment accounts belong to the registered player can prevent avoidable delays. Users should never share passwords, one-time codes, or access details with another person.
Build a Safer Playing Routine
Responsible gambling begins before the first game. A fixed entertainment budget, a time limit, and regular breaks can help keep play within comfortable boundaries. Money needed for rent, bills, savings, or essential spending should never be used for casino activity.
- Set a deposit limit before starting.
- Use session reminders to monitor time.
- Never chase losses by increasing stakes.
- Keep gambling separate from borrowing or credit pressure.
- Pause play and seek independent support if control becomes difficult.
Tools such as cooling-off periods, deposit blocks, reality checks, and self-exclusion can support healthier decisions. A reputable operator should present these options clearly rather than treating them as hidden account settings.
